Why Reliable Window Repair Is Essential
Reliable window repair can improve the performance and appearance of your windows while preventing costly future repairs. Here are some crucial factors why window repair need to be on your home upkeep checklist:

Energy Efficiency: Poorly sealed or damaged windows can cause significant heat loss during winter season and heat gain throughout summertime. This ineffectiveness forces your heating and cooling systems to work harder, increasing your energy costs.

Security: Damaged windows can jeopardize your home's security, making it easier for intruders to get.

Visual Appeal: Well-maintained windows improve your home's curb appeal and increase its market price. Windows are among the very first things potential buyers notification.

Comfort: Properly functioning windows keep drafts at bay, maintaining a comfortable indoor temperature throughout the year.

Avoid Bigger Issues: Ignoring small window problems can lead to more considerable damage with time, resulting in pricey repairs or replacements.

Repairing windows can be an uncomplicated process if you follow the correct steps. Below is a list of vital steps every property owner ought to consider for reliable window repair:

Assess the Damage: Start by examining your windows for any visible damage. Search for fractures, gaps, and signs of moisture.

Select the Right Tools: Equip yourself with the required tools, which might include a sealant, replacement glass, weatherstripping, a caulking gun, and basic hand tools.

Get Rid Of Old Seals: If you're handling drafts, carefully get rid of old seals or weatherstripping before applying brand-new products.

Use New Sealant: Use a top quality sealant to fill out gaps and cracks. For windows with wooden frames, think about using paintable sealant that matches your existing frame color.

Change Broken Glass: For cracked or shattered window panes, take accurate measurements and purchase replacement glass that matches. If you're uncomfortable dealing with local glass repair, hiring a professional may be best.

Strengthen Security Measures: Consider adding custom window repair locks or security movies to boost your windows' security.

Regular Maintenance: After the repairs, schedule regular checks to ensure your windows remain in great condition. Clean tracks, oil moving parts, and change any damaged weatherstripping as required.

Q: How can I tell if my window seals are broken?A: Look for signs of condensation between the panes, drafts, or visible temperature distinctions near the window. Q: Is it worth it to repair windows rather of replacing them?A: It typically depends on the level of the damage. Minor concerns can be fixed cost-effectively, while substantial damage may necessitate a full replacement. Q: How much does window repair generally cost?A: Repair expenses can differ commonly based on the type of repair required and your area, averaging in between ₤ 100 to ₤ 500 per window. Q: How typically need to I check my windows?A: It's recommended to inspect your windows at least as soon as a year, ideally before seasonal changes, to catch early signs of wear. Q: Can I carry out window rot repair repairs myself?A: Many small repairs can be done by property owners, however for complex problems or safety concerns, it's best to speak with a professional.
